![]() It’s terribly difficult, because Aunt Bee is so much nicer than the real me. “Sooner or later, your mind begins to click and in my case you are wise to seek professional help to help stop being Aunt Bee after work. “You can’t be an actress for 40 years, living in a world of make-believe, and not be affected,” she told the Star-Gazetteof Elmira, New York, in 1966. Frances Bavier, America’s favorite aunt, had a reputation of being easily offended and didn’t appreciate the role that made her a household name. When cameras weren’t rolling, at least one of those characters was known for being hard to work with. ![]() Along with the rest of the show’s cast, including Floyd the barber, Otis the town drunk, gas station attendants Gomer and Goober Pyle and many more, the Taylor family represented a closeness of family and community that represents many small towns across the country. He was joined by his dim witted yet charming deputy, Barney Fife played by Don Knotts, Taylor’s son Opie, portrayed by a young Ron Howard, and Taylor’s Aunt Bee, played by Frances Bavier. Set in Mayberry, North Carolina, The Andy Griffith Show ran for eight years and starred Griffith as small town sheriff Andy Taylor. But, behind the scenes, some of the actors didn’t get along as well as their on-screen characters did. The show’s unforgettable characters cemented their places in television history and in the hearts of generations of the show’s fans. It’s been more than 60 years since The Andy Griffith Show premiered on CBS.
